Sponsors Want Custom Options

By Julia / January 1, 2020

Sponsors no longer want boxed Gold, Silver and Bronze sponsorship options. Sponsors are looking for custom options that will meet their marketing needs. The only way you are going to know what the sponsor really wants and needs is to ask them.
